Abstract

The ball-end milling cutter is widely used in the machining of various complex curved surfaces and grooves. In order to meet the machining requirements of SiCp/Al, the mathematical model of ball end milling cutter, grinding track of grinding wheel and parameters in the actual machining process are optimized, and the experiment of milling SiCp/Al is designed. The results show that the surface roughness processed by the grinding tool is small. In the process of milling SiCp/Al, the main wear position of ball end milling cutter is the flank.
